For Inktomi, having 140 pages of your site indexed is not bad. It crawls slowly, and adds pages to the index even more slowly. As far as I know, when you pay Inktomi, you're only paying *per page*, not for the whole site.

Now, if your pages are on Inktomi but have a bad ranking, you probably just need to work on your keywords (especially in the titles). (Then wait a month or two for Inktomi to get the changes).

Also, be sure that when you search Yahoo, you're really getting Inktomi results -- they usually use Google, though they might be switching to Ink.
